Common reasons for delays
With over 25 years of experience in the drainage industry, we’ve seen it all. The most common reasons for delays in main drain connections usually boil down to the absence of key information at the start of the project. Without clear information on the method of connection and marked sketches to identify key components, delays are inevitable.
Here are some crucial questions that need answers to avoid delays:
- What new inspection chambers are required?
- Where are the existing inspection chambers?
- Where is the point of connection located?
- Is there a requirement for a pumping station?
- What size pipes are needed?
Getting clear answers to these questions ensures an informed method of connection and a well-planned project.

Before starting work, we carry out thorough research to locate and inspect the drains, inspection chambers, and connection points. We also obtain permission from the appropriate authorities, including a permit to work on the public highway if needed.
For a small fee, our specialist team can acquire a sewer utility map of the area, identifying different types of sewers in the network, such as foul water sewers, surface water sewers, combined sewers, and trade sewers. Using CCTV, we inspect existing drains to ensure they are in good working order and test for rainwater in the system. This front-end work eliminates issues that could arise later on.
During our initial research and surveys, we determine if a pumping main is required. This is a pipe that pushes sewage up to and into the inspection chamber, allowing it to freefall into the main public sewer. Identifying the distance that needs to be covered by the pumping main at this stage is crucial.
